ClustalParser-1.0.0: Libary for parsing Clustal tools output

Safe HaskellSafe-Inferred
LanguageHaskell98

Bio.ClustalParser

Description

Parse Clustal output

Synopsis

Documentation

parseClustalAlignment :: String -> Either ParseError ClustalAlignment Source

Parse Clustal alignment (.aln) from String

readClustalAlignment :: String -> IO (Either ParseError ClustalAlignment) Source

Parse Clustal alignment (.aln) from filehandle

parseClustalSummary :: String -> Either ParseError ClustalSummary Source

Parse Clustal summary (printed to STDOUT) from String

readClustalSummary :: String -> IO (Either ParseError ClustalSummary) Source

Parse Clustal summary (printed to STDOUT) from file

data ClustalSummary Source

Data type for clustal summary, containing information about the alignment process, usually printed to STDOUT

data ClustalAlignment Source

Data structure for Clustal alignment format